SPY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2018 in Review

1,903 of the 4,369 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in State Street SPDR S&P 500 ETF Trust (SPY) for Q2 2018, worth a combined $174B — up 1.8% from $171B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 107 funds opened new SPY positions and 104 closed out — a net gain of 3 holders — while 764 added to existing stakes and 778 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Bank of America, adding an estimated $8.93B. The largest seller was HSBC Holdings, cutting an estimated $3.41B.
